# Settings: EXIF scrubbing (discussed at weekly sync)
# The Pinewhistle uploader strips all EXIF blocks except orientation
# before images reach object storage. Scrub results are audited in a
# ledger table so we can prove no GPS data survived ingestion.
# Failures quarantine the file and log a row for review.
# The audit writer authenticates to the ledger database using the
# connection string below.

primary connection of tawif-yajeg = postgresql://rusiel_svc:G879q9cx6GsSvj@db-dd9f.norvagrid.internal:5432/casath

## Releases

Every release of the Fenwick Schema Registry is built from a tagged commit and published to the internal Corvid artifact store. On-call engineers should verify that the compatibility suite passed for all registered event schemas before promoting a build. Rollbacks must restore both the binary and the schema snapshot together. Sign the release manifest with the key below.

rollout seal: bky4_x7Gc

Subject: DR drill — ImportForge CSV wizard

Plugin authors: the Bramblewick disaster-recovery drill runs Thursday. ImportForge's CSV wizard will fail over to the standby region; expect brief mapping-cache resets. Test your column-mapping hooks afterward and file issues against the drill tag. To unlock the drill sandbox, use the passphrase below.

strongbox words: gilok-druion-briath-wendor-briion-prawyn-fenion-oliir-casdor-holius-briius-gilath-gilael-pelys

Escalation — LiftLogic Simulator. So the dispatch sim (the thing that fakes elevator traffic for the Pendlebrook towers demo) sometimes wedges when two virtual cars claim the same floor. First step: restart the scheduler pod and replay the last scenario file. If it wedges again within an hour, that's a real bug, not flakiness — page the sim-core rotation. Don't try to hand-edit the scenario queue; it never ends well. If you're unsure whether something counts as an escalation, just ask first.

escalation mailbox, bafog-fafog: ulador@paliqlabs.internal